Check whether – 150 is a term of the AP : 11, 8, 5, 2 . . .

For this A.P.,
a = 11
d = a2 − a1 
   = 8 − 11 = −3
Let −150 be the n th term of this A.P.

We know that,
an = a + (n − 1) d
-150 = 11 + (n - 1)(-3)
-150 = 11 - 3n + 3
-164 = -3n
n = 164/3
Clearly, n is not an integer.
Therefore, - 150 is not a term of this A.P.
